The upcoming International Ethnic Expo 2026, set to take place in August at the India Expo Mart, will serve as a premier platform for B2B trade, focusing on India’s diverse ethnic wear. This event promises to attract a considerable number of exhibitors and international buyers, aiming to amplify trade relations not just within India but across Southeast Asia, particularly in ASEAN markets such as Indonesia.
With the growing global demand for ethnic and traditional garments, the International Ethnic Expo represents a timely opportunity for businesses to tap into this expanding market. The event is expected to foster connections between manufacturers and buyers, enhancing visibility for Indian textiles on an international scale.

As the expo attracts participants from across the ASEAN region, it serves as a vital link for Indian manufacturers to establish relationships with importers and distributors in countries like Indonesia, Malaysia, and Thailand. The trade connections formed here can lead to enhanced exports, promoting economic growth in both India and its neighboring markets.
